Launched in September 2020, the UK-Nigeria Tech Hub announced  it’s Building From Ground Up (virtual series) programmed aimed at providing a platform for upcoming entrepreneurs to learn and gain insights from the successes and lessons learnt from the entrepreneurial journey of startup founders, innovators and entrepreneurs on how they built their companies from ground up!.

The Building From Ground Up series has gained a lot of traction in the Nigerian Tech-Ecosystem, as it has, in previous episodes, featured stories from startup founders such as Dr Ola Brown, Founder of  Flying Doctors, Shola Akinlade, Co-Founder of Paystack, Temie Giwa-Tubosun, Founder of LifeBank and Onyekachi Izukanne, Co-Founder/CEO of TradeDepot. 

To mark the episode for February and with Tech Point Africa has its implementing partners, the UK-Nigeria Tech Hub will be hosting Opeyemi Awoyemi, a serial entrepreneur who has founded several companies including  Jobberman, Moneymie, WhoGoHost and just recently TalentQL.

In this episode slated for February 22nd by 11am, Opeyemi will share what his entrepreneurship journey has been like, building companies,the failures, the successes and lessons learnt.

About UK-Nigeria Tech Hub:

The UK-Nigeria Tech Hub has been established as part of the UK’s Digital Access Program (DAP), a UK Government Prosperity Fund Initiative. The UK-Nigeria Tech Hub aims to develop a stronger Nigerian digital ecosystem through the development of skills, entrepreneurship and business partnerships.

About Techpoint Africa:

Techpoint Africa is a technology company that amplifies the best innovations out of Africa through its media, data, events and tech focused platforms.
